Lead Scheduler, Commercial Overview

We are se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ented Lead Scheduler, Commercial to join our dynamic team.

Responsibilities
  • Develop, maintain, and manage detailed project schedules using Primavera P6 to ensure timely delivery of commercial projects.
  • Collaborate with project managers, engineers, and other stakeholders to gather input and ensure alignment on project timelines and milestones.
  • Monitor project progress, identify potential delays, and propose mitigation strategies to keep projects on track.
  • Analyze schedule performance and provide regular updates and reports to senior management and project teams.
  • Ensure compliance with company standards, policies, and procedures related to scheduling and project management.
  • Conduct risk assessments and integrate risk mitigation plans into project schedules.
  • Lead scheduling meetings and workshops to communicate timelines, address concerns, and foster collaboration among team members.
  • Continuously improve scheduling processes and tools to enhance efficiency and accuracy.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field.
  • Proven experience in project scheduling, with a focus on commercial projects.
  • Proficiency in Primavera P6.
  • Strong understanding of project management principles, critical path method (CPM), and resource allocation.
  • Excellent anal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ams.
  • Certification in project scheduling or project management (e.g., PMI-SP, PMP) is a plus.
